WebbThe 2024 average tuition & fees of the schools in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ania is $22,626 for Pennsylvania residents and $23,465 for out-of-state students. The average acceptance rate is 70.53% and the average SAT score is 1,214. A total of 81,505 students enrolled in schools in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ania, of which 6,856 students enrolled in online ... Carnegie Mellon University is a private not-for-profit university based in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ania. It is an institution with an enrollment of over 1,676 bachelor’s degree candidates. The admission criteria is somewhat competitive with the acceptance rate of 22 %. # 1 in Best Computer Science Colleges & Universities in Pennsylvania.
